​The past perfect tense is used to show that something happened before another action in the past.

The past perfect, sometimes called pluperfect, describes events in the past. This is a specific type of tense and even when it seems hard to use, it is actually pretty easy. This tense describes events that happened in the middle of another event in the past, or which „passed in the past“. To construct the past perfect tense, we need to know all the irregular verbs and their forms.
